Cover Legend SEM of a section cut through an internode region of a Brachypodium distachyon stem. Like many grasses the stem is hollow with a central lacuna surrounded by a cortical region containing several rings of vascular bundles; the larger innermost bundles are surrounded by chlorenchyma cells, the smaller outer bundles are partially embedded in a sub‐epidermal sclerenchymatous sheath. Micrograph courtesy of Glenn Turner (Smertenko et al ., pp 1681–1695). Read more about our covers in the ‘Behind the cover’ blog: newphytologist.org/behind-the-cover .
